Attendees: R. Falkner, J. Omusi, T. Brandt. The group reviewed next year's headcount plan across all Torvik Systems branches. Agreed: net growth capped at 4%, with new roles weighted toward the Elmsgate service desk and field engineering. Backfills require regional sign-off; contractor conversions count against the cap. Branch managers must submit draft org charts by end of month. No freeze is planned, but discretionary hires pause in Q4. Minutes close with one confidential note on business plans, recorded below.

internal memo for kawip-hadug: Headcount on the Wenwyn team goes from 7 to 140 by the end of January. Gross margin on Wenwyn came in at 20 percent against a plan of 15 percent.

Q: Can I use the goods lift at Pelton Yard? A: Only if you're moving actual deliveries — it's reserved for couriers and facilities, so no sneaky shortcuts with your lunch. If you do have a legit bulky delivery to move, book a slot with the post room first. The lift panel is code-locked, and the current access code is:

door code, tahof-yajog: bdg-C-65

## Further Reading

The profile store behind Lumenfeed is sharded by user ID across twelve partitions. Rebalancing is manual and should never be attempted during peak hours. Before touching shard assignments, review the rebalance checklist and the hash-ring diagram, both maintained by the Datapath team. The full sharding design notes and failure scenarios are kept on the internal wiki page below.

runbook for badug-kadup: https://confluence.zemvarlabs.internal/projects/browse/display/projects/bd1b

## Account Recovery — Trailnote Offline Mode

When a surveyor's Trailnote app has been offline for 30+ days, their local credentials expire and sync refuses to resume. Don't make them wipe the device — all their unsynced field data lives there! Instead, open the support console, pick "Offline Reinstate," and enter their handle. The console will ask for the support team's shared recovery passphrase before issuing a reinstatement token. Use the one below.

unlock words, bagaf-fajeg: zorael-kelax-fraath-quenix-eliok-sileth-aldmir-wenir-druiel